Colors, STAR Plus, Zee all up

The top three Hindi GECs, Colors, STAR Plus and Zee have delivered improved numbers when compared to the previous week according to TAM (HSM, CS 4+, Week 51).
 
Colors was at 303 GRPs, STAR Plus at 280 and Zee at 271.
 
Sony was at 179, NDTV Imagine at 90 and SAB was at 83.
